Layer thickness measurement according to the wedge cut method

Determination of the coating thickness on metallic and non-metallic base materials and coatings.

Universal coating thickness measurement using the wedge cut method

Universal coating thickness measurement

  • Coating thickness measurement on all coatings on any substrates (metallic and non-metallic base materials and coatings)
  • Measurement of individual layers in multi-layer systems
  • d = s * tan(α)
  • Standards
    • DIN 50968
    • ISO 2808
    • ASTM D 4138
    • ASTM D 5796

Carbide cutting edges for wedge cut

Cutting edge No. 1
  • Measuring range: 20 - 2000 µm
  • Cutting angle (α): 45.0°
  • Factor (µm/Sct.): 20
Cutting edge No. 2
  • Measuring range: 10 - 1000 µm
  • Cutting angle (α): 26.6°
  • Factor (µm/Sct.): 10
Cutting edge No. 3
  • Measuring range: 5 - 500 µm
  • Cutting angle (α): 14.0°
  • Factor (µm/Sct.): 5
Cutting edge No. 4
  • Measuring range: 2 - 200 µm
  • Cutting angle (α): 5.7°
  • Factor (µm/Sct.): 5
